Question 271833: A boat on a river travels the same distance in 1/2 hour downstream as it can go upstream for an hour. If the boat travels 12 mph in still water, what is the speed of the current?

If the boat travels 12 mph in still water, what is the speed of the current?
:
Let c = speed of the current
then
(12-c) = speed upstream
and
(12+c) = speed downstream
:
A distance equation
1(12-c) = .5(12+c)
12 - c = 6 + .5c
12 - 6 = .5c + c
6 = 1.5c
c =
c = 4 mph is the current
:
:
Confirms this by finding the distance
12-4 = .5(12+4)
